  • Abstract
    This paper presents a device that is able to reproduce atmospheric discharges in a small scale. First, there was simulated an impulse generator circuit that could meet the main characteristics of the common lightning strokes waveform. Later, four different generator circuits were developed with the selection made by a microcontroller. Finally, the output was subject to amplification circuits that increased its amplitude. The impulses generated had a very similar shape compared to the real atmospheric discharges to the international standards for impulse testing. The apparatus is meant for application in electric grounding systems and for tests in high frequency to measure the soil impedance.
